  2. Question:Arrange the fractions `5/8, 7/12, 13/16, 16/29,`and `3/4` in acsending order of magnitude. 

    Answer
    Converting  each of the given fraction into decimal form, we get :
    
    `5/8 = 0.625, 7/12 = 0.5833, 13/16`
    
    ` = 0.8125, 16/29 = 0.5517 & 3/4 = 0.75`.
     
     Now `0.5517 < 0.5833 < 0.625 <0.75 < 0.8125`
     
     :. `16/29 < 7/12 <5/8 <3/4 < 13/16`.
